Dhaka, Nov 16 (V7N) – The Border Guard Bangladesh (BGB) has been deployed in Dhaka and four surrounding districts to maintain law and order amid recent unrest and security concerns.

According to a statement from the BGB headquarters on Sunday, the force is on duty in Dhaka, Gopalganj, Faridpur, and Madaripur districts to ensure overall security and prevent any law and order disturbances.

The deployment comes ahead of the scheduled verdict in the case of ousted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ina over alleged crimes against humanity, which is set to be announced on Monday (November 17).

Authorities noted that in recent days, incidents of sabotage, including cocktail explosions, arson attacks on vehicles, and the burning of July memorials, have occurred in various parts of the country, including the capital. The BGB’s presence aims to maintain peace and prevent further disruptions around the verdict.
